If josh can run 2 miles in 15 minutes. How many miles can he run in 2 hours?

IRISSAK [1]3 years ago
4 0
2 miles - 15 mins
4 miles - 30 mins
6 miles - 45 mins
8 miles - 60 mins
10 miles - 75 mins
12 miles - 90 mins
14 miles - 105 mins
16 miles - 120 mins (2 hours)


Josh can run 16 miles in 2 hours
